summaryrefslogtreecommitdiff
path: root/src/shared/path-lookup.h
AgeCommit message (Expand)AuthorFilesLines
2018-10-08path-lookup: define explicit unit file directory for attached unit filesLennart Poettering1-0/+6
2018-06-14tree-wide: remove Lennart's copyright linesLennart Poettering1-4/+0
2018-06-14tree-wide: drop 'This file is part of systemd' blurbLennart Poettering1-2/+0
2018-06-12tree-wide: unify how we define bit mak enumsLennart Poettering1-3/+3
2018-05-24path-lookup: add flag to optionally force checking split-usr unit dirsLennart Poettering1-2/+3
2018-04-25tree-wide: drop redundant _cleanup_ macros (#8810)Lennart Poettering1-1/+0
2018-04-06tree-wide: drop license boilerplateZbigniew Jędrzejewski-Szmek1-13/+0
2017-12-06shared: export xdg_user_dirs() and xdg_user_*_dir()Zbigniew Jędrzejewski-Szmek1-0/+4
2017-11-29path-lookup: LookupPathsFlags are a flags type, hence define it like oneLennart Poettering1-2/+2
2017-11-19Add SPDX license identifiers to source files under the LGPLZbigniew Jędrzejewski-Szmek1-0/+1
2017-09-22install: consider globally enabled units as "enabled" for the userZbigniew Jędrzejewski-Szmek1-0/+2
2017-09-14core/manager: when running in test mode, use a temp dir for generated stuffZbigniew Jędrzejewski-Szmek1-0/+4
2016-04-12systemctl: don't confuse sysv code with generated unitsLennart Poettering1-1/+5
2016-04-12path-lookup: move generator_binary_paths() to end of fileLennart Poettering1-2/+2
2016-04-12core: introduce a "control" unit file directoryLennart Poettering1-3/+16
2016-04-12install: rename generator_paths() → generator_binary_paths()Lennart Poettering1-1/+1
2016-04-12core: move flushing of generated unit files to path-lookup.cLennart Poettering1-0/+1
2016-04-12path-lookup: stop exporting two functionsLennart Poettering1-3/+0
2016-04-12core: rework logic to drop duplicate and non-existing items from search pathLennart Poettering1-0/+2
2016-04-12path-lookup: split out logic for mkdir/rmdir of generator dirs in their own f...Lennart Poettering1-0/+3
2016-04-12core: add a separate unit directory for transient unitsLennart Poettering1-0/+3
2016-04-12install: add root directory to LookupPaths structureLennart Poettering1-0/+3
2016-04-12core: remove ManagerRunningAs enumLennart Poettering1-11/+2
2016-04-12core: add configuration directories to LookupPathsLennart Poettering1-0/+6
2016-04-12core: rework generator dir logic, move the dirs into LookupPaths structureLennart Poettering1-18/+15
2016-04-12core: drop SysV paths from path-lookup logicLennart Poettering1-4/+0
2016-02-10tree-wide: remove Emacs lines from all filesDaniel Mack1-2/+0
2015-12-06shared: include what we useThomas Hindoe Paaboel Andersen1-0/+1
2015-05-11install: when exporting prefix InstallInfo to become UnitFileInstallInfoLennart Poettering1-3/+4
2015-05-11core: rename SystemdRunningAs to ManagerRunningAsLennart Poettering1-8/+8
2015-03-14sysv-generator: initialize LookupPaths just onceZbigniew Jędrzejewski-Szmek1-1/+2
2015-01-11Implement masking and overriding of generatorsZbigniew Jędrzejewski-Szmek1-0/+2
2015-01-05path-lookup, systemctl: export lookup_paths_init_from_scope() from shared/ins...Ivan Shapovalov1-0/+4
2014-10-02Rename user_runtime to user_runtime_dirZbigniew Jędrzejewski-Szmek1-1/+1
2014-10-02add a transient user unit directorySteven Allen1-0/+1
2014-08-21install: simplify usage of _cleanup_ macrosLennart Poettering1-2/+2
2014-07-19core: remove systemd_running_as lookup functionsZbigniew Jędrzejewski-Szmek1-3/+0
2014-06-30Move x-systemd-device.timeout handling from core to fstab-generatorZbigniew Jędrzejewski-Szmek1-0/+2
2014-05-15Make systemctl --root look for files in the proper placesZbigniew Jędrzejewski-Szmek1-1/+7
2013-10-27path_lookup: moved _cleanup_lookup_paths_free_ from install.c to path-lookup.hDaniel Buch1-0/+2
2013-05-02Add __attribute__((const, pure, format)) in various placesZbigniew Jędrzejewski-Szmek1-2/+2
2012-09-18core: move ManagerRunningAs to sharedZbigniew Jędrzejewski-Szmek1-2/+10
2012-07-19use #pragma once instead of foo*foo #define guardsShawn Landden1-4/+1
2012-05-23manager: rework generator logicLennart Poettering1-1/+1
2012-04-12move more common files to shared/ and add them to shared.laKay Sievers1-0/+40